
About Fire Fighters Charity
Fire Fighters Charity is the UK’s leading provider of health, wellbeing and support services for the fire and rescue community.
We support firefighters, fire and rescue staff and their families through physical rehabilitation, psychological support, wellbeing services, prevention and 24/7 crisis care. Our services are national in reach and deeply personal in impact. We help people recover, stay well and build resilience at every stage of their journey. We are focused on delivering modern, joined-up services that reflect the real and evolving needs of our community.
The role
We are looking for a senior executive leader to join us as Director of Services, leading our national portfolio of health, wellbeing, rehabilitation, psychological and crisis services.
This is a key leadership role with responsibility for ensuring services are safe, effective and consistently delivered to a high standard across the UK. You will lead the ongoing development and transformation of integrated services across prevention, early intervention, recovery and long-term wellbeing. This includes inpatient, outpatient, community, digital and 24/7 crisis pathways. Working closely with the Chief Executive and Senior Leadership Team, you will help shape organisational strategy and ensure our services continue to evolve in line with national policy, best practice and the needs of the fire and rescue community. You will also hold senior responsibility for governance, safeguarding, risk, workforce and performance across all services.
Key responsibilities
As Director of Services, you will:
• Lead the delivery of Fire Fighters Charity’s national health, wellbeing, rehabilitation, psychological and crisis services
• Ensure services are safe, effective, person-centred and focused on improving outcomes
• Oversee clinical governance, safeguarding, risk and organisational learning across all services
• Drive service transformation, including redesign of pathways and development of digital, remote and hybrid models of care
• Oversee national 24/7 crisis services, ensuring safe and effective triage, escalation and support for people in acute distress
• Lead workforce strategy and culture across a diverse multi-disciplinary workforce, ensuring capability, resilience and high-quality practice
• Ensure services are trauma-informed, recovery-focused and aligned with national guidance and best practice
• Lead performance, quality and outcomes frameworks to support improvement, assurance and decision-making
• Build strong partnerships with NHS organisations, Fire and Rescue Services and voluntary sector partners
• Act as a senior advisor to the Chief Executive and Board on service performance, risk, workforce and strategy
